你查询的IP:[222.64.108.139]  地理位置:中国–上海–上海–闵行区

最新查询122.119.221.13 118.230.111.105 122.136.30.138 125.112.2.216 114.80.149.113 116.198.197.155 122.64.12.242 123.4.203.127 119.78.113.139 222.64.108.139 116.213.64.73 123.112.141.234 121.55.30.36 203.80.144.164 60.194.154.141 118.239.102.140 221.199.195.140 116.112.139.203 221.208.184.133 58.14.141.207 202.127.208.152 210.26.165.9 120.72.128.212 221.93.83.163 203.223.11.209 203.208.86.70 119.40.210.75 203.86.15.67 117.74.128.14 118.91.240.9 58.14.53.167